  • #98 Rewire, Reinforce, Repeat: Anchoring as Your Keto Vegan Superpower
    Jul 10 2025

    Welcome back to The Keto Vegan! I’m Rach, your host—part psychology geek, part plant-based fat enthusiast—and today we’re diving into something a bit magical 🧠✨. It’s called anchoring, and it’s a brilliant little NLP trick that helps you lock in confidence, calm, or courage on demand—like carrying your own emotional support smoothie in your brain 🥬💪.

    Step By Step Process

    1️⃣ Identify a difficult situation in which you’d like to feel more resourceful/confident/capable etc. 😩➡️💪 2️⃣ Identify the resource you want in this situation ‘x’ (e.g. courage, confidence, calm, patience etc.) 🌟🧘‍♀️🔥 3️⃣ Remember your best example of having experienced that state in your life (in an unrelated situation). If you don’t have one, think of someone else who does—real or fictional. 🧠🎬👑 4️⃣ Think about that ‘x’—what else might it give you? 🌈💥 5️⃣ Find a word or phrase that captures it for you—one that really evokes the feeling. 🗣️🧡 6️⃣ With this memory and feeling in mind, ask yourself: would you breathe it in or out? 🌬️⬅️➡️ 7️⃣ Choose a unique physical gesture (e.g. thumb and finger squeeze) 🤏—something subtle you can do anywhere. 8️⃣ Take a few breaths and get comfy 😌🛋️. Close your eyes to block out distractions 🙈. 9️⃣ Access your chosen memory—step into it. See what you saw 👀, hear what you heard 👂, feel what you felt ❤️. Fully associate with it. If you chose a person, step into them too. 🔟 When the feeling peaks 🎯, say your word, do your breath and your gesture—anchor it 🧷. Then open your eyes when you’re ready 👁️. 1️⃣1️⃣ Break the state by saying your phone number aloud 📞💬. 1️⃣2️⃣ Close your eyes and go back again. Your brilliant brain 🧠 will know exactly what to do. 1️⃣3️⃣ Revisit the memory: see 👁️, hear 👂, feel ❤️. Let it peak again. Say your word, breathe, do the gesture. Then open your eyes. 🔁 1️⃣4️⃣ Break the state again—this time, spot something green around you 💚🪴. 1️⃣5️⃣ Repeat the whole anchoring process at least three times ⏱️🔁✅.

    💡 Pro tip: Keep firing off that anchor as often as possible. Your brain loves patterns—so it’ll start resurrecting that powerful feeling when you need it most 🔄🧠⚡.

  • #97 Self-Love Is the Secret Sauce: Emotional Healing for the Keto Vegan Life
    Jul 3 2025

    Today we’re exploring self‑love—why it’s foundational not just to wellness, but to your keto‑vegan lifestyle. In the last episode, I talked about emotional eating; in this one, I’m taking it deeper: if we don’t truly love ourselves, our self‑esteem wobbles, and we’re giving from an empty cup. Let’s journey into raising vibration, working with the unconscious mind, and using visualisations and meditations (plus a sprinkle of hypnotherapy insight) to build unconditional self‑worth.

    ✨ Key Takeaways

    1. Self-love grounds you: A solid sense of self-esteem makes external triggers less impactful.
    2. Unconscious mind works in safety mode: It holds onto past fears and patterns—even in self-worth—until gently rewired.
    3. Raise your vibration daily: Use positive memories or future visualisations to lift your emotional state by small, consistent steps.
    4. Intentions + gratitude = internal shift: Journaling three things you’re grateful for (or setting daily intentions) boosts self-appreciation and resilience.
    5. Be kind to your unconscious mind: Don’t dig into past trauma unprepared—replace neural grooves of self‑judgment with gratitude, forgiveness, and self-compassion.
    6. Protective shield & loving-kindness meditations: You can train your mind to cleanse negativity and send compassion—even to those challenging people in your life.

  • #96 Eating Emotions: How to Stop Using Food to Numb Your Feelings
    Jun 26 2025

    Welcome to another honest, heart-forward episode of The Keto Vegan! This time, I’m diving deep into the real reason so many of us slip—even when we’re ticking all the keto vegan boxes. You know the proteins, you’ve nailed intermittent fasting, your wee strips are showing dark red… and yet the cravings still creep in. Why? Because emotions, my loves. This one’s all about how we eat our feelings—and how we can stop.

    In this episode, I share the mental hack that’s helping me beat those carb-obsessed urges, plus why it’s not just about willpower. I’ll walk you through the two-minute craving reset technique that literally reprogrammes your brain—and how to spot the emotional saboteurs behind your binges.

    ✨ Key Takeaways

    • It’s Not Lack of Knowledge, It’s Emotion: Most of us know what to eat—we fall down because we're eating to avoid emotions, not because we're hungry.
    • The Primitive Mind is in Charge: Your unconscious mind is like a six-year-old running your snack drawer. Learn to parent it, not obey it.
    • The Two-Minute Rule Works: When cravings hit, stop everything, move to a ‘safe space’ and set a two-minute timer. Feel the feelings instead.
    • Permission, Not Punishment: After your two minutes, you can eat the thing. But often, you won't want to anymore.
    • Loneliness is a Big Trigger: Many emotional eating patterns stem from loneliness—even when we pride ourselves on being strong and independent.
    • You Are Not Weak, You’re Human: Recognising and processing emotions builds real, lasting strength. Don’t be afraid to ask for help.
